16 NORFOLK AVENUE is a very small semi-detached house of 58m², built sometime between 1967 and 1975, which could now be worth an estimated £300,689. It was last sold for £195,000 in June 2014, which was around 8% above the average June 2014 semi-detached price in the West Suffolk local authority area. The most recent EPC inspection was February 2014, where the current energy rating was C, and the potential energy rating was B.

16 NORFOLK AVENUE Price Paid vs. HPI Average

The below graph shows the average semi-detached house price in the West Suffolk local authority area over time, sourced from the HPI. The four 16 NORFOLK AVENUE sales between January 2004 and June 2014 have been plotted on the graph. A line has been extrapolated to show what the value of the property might have been over time, following each sale, had it maintained the same margin above or below the HPI (as a percentage). For example, the January 2009 sale was for 9% above the HPI. So the extrapolation line tracks at 9% above the HPI over time, until the June 2014 sale, where it falls to 8% above the HPI. The line then continues to track at 8% above the HPI.

What might 16 NORFOLK AVENUE be worth now?

16 NORFOLK AVENUE might now be worth an estimated £300,689.

This is based on house price inflation of 54.2%, between June 2014 and July 2025, for semi-detached houses, in the West Suffolk local authority area, as calculated by the Office for National Statistics and published in their UK House Price Index (HPI).

The 54.2% inflationary increase is applied to the most recent sale price for 16 NORFOLK AVENUE of £195,000 on 12th June 2014. For the value to have increased from £195,000 to £300,689 over the ten years and eleven months to July 2025, the following assumptions must hold true:

  • The value of 16 NORFOLK AVENUE has moved in line with the HPI for semi-detached houses in the West Suffolk local authority area.
  • The June 2014 sale price of £195,000 represented a fair market value for the property.
  • The size, condition, and specification of 16 NORFOLK AVENUE has not materially changed since June 2014.
Disclaimer: Please note that this is a theoretical estimate based on assumptions which may or may not be correct. It should not be relied on for any purpose.
